Jose Mourinho is keeping an open mind about Real Madrid's Champions League chances against Lyon in the first knockout round.

The man who has won two Champions League titles as managers of Porto and Inter says he will do all he can to reverse Real's recent record of not getting past the last sixteen in the last six years.

He said: "Real Madrid are a top club in European history with nine European Cups so I think it is time to stop with this negative period."

Despite winning two Premier League titles with Chelsea, the Champions League was one success to elude him. He warns current manager Carlo Ancelotti not to take opponents FC Copenhagen too lightly.

"He knows he has to respect Copenhagen because Copenhagen showed in the group phase that they don't have the same potential they don't have the same talent as other teams but they are very well organised and they have self belief."

As for Arsenal, Mourinho says they have only themselves to blame for landing favourites Barcelona. "So if they play against Barcelona it is because they didn't do very well in the group stage so they are paying for it."
